The Three NFPA Levels

The Three NFPA Chimney Inspection Levels Explained in Westville, IL

Level 1

The Annual Baseline Check in Westville

Annual safety baseline for chimneys in regular service with the same appliance and no system changes in Westville, IL. Visual inspection of accessible portions without special equipment in Westville. Firebox, damper, visible smoke chamber, as much of the flue as can be seen, accessible exterior components in Westville, IL. Topdown Chimney includes a basic Level 1 assessment with every sweep service in Westville.

Level 2

The Camera Scan That Sees What Nothing Else Can in Westville, IL

Everything in Level 1 plus a full camera scan of the flue interior and a written inspection report in Westville. The camera scan is the element that makes Level 2 fundamentally more revealing than Level 1 in Westville, IL. NFPA 211 requires Level 2 when a property changes hands in Westville. Also required after any chimney fire, fuel type change, or when Level 1 findings warrant closer examination in Westville, IL.

Level 3

When the Structure Needs Invasive Assessment in Westville

Involves removing structural components to access concealed areas when Level 2 findings cannot be fully characterized through camera scan alone in Westville, IL. May require removing masonry, chimney components, or adjacent building materials in Westville. Topdown Chimney performs Level 3 when Level 2 findings genuinely warrant it and explains clearly before proceeding in Westville, IL.

After Any Suspected or Confirmed Chimney Fire in Westville

The heat of a chimney fire exceeds 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it and causes clay tile liners to expand and contract rapidly, cracking tile sections and separating mortar joints in Westville, IL. Level 2 camera inspection after any suspected chimney fire is essential before the fireplace is used again in Westville.

What We Assess

What Topdown Chimney Assesses During Every Inspection in Westville, IL

Firebox and Damper — The Starting Point in Westville

The firebox refractory brick and mortar are inspected for cracking, spalling, and structural deterioration in Westville, IL. The damper is assessed for correct operation, physical condition including corrosion and deformation, and adequate seal when closed in Westville. The transition between the firebox and smoke chamber is assessed for smoke chamber parge coat condition in Westville, IL.

Flue Liner — Visual at Level 1, Camera at Level 2 in Westville

At Level 1, the flue liner is assessed through visual inspection from the firebox opening and from the chimney top in Westville, IL. At Level 2, the complete liner is documented through camera scan providing direct visual evidence of liner condition throughout the full flue height in Westville. Crack location and severity. Mortar joint condition between tile sections. Physical liner damage from chimney fires. Liner sizing relative to the connected appliance in Westville, IL.

Crown, Cap, Flashing, and Exterior Masonry in Westville, IL

The chimney crown is inspected from rooftop level for cracking, correct formation, and structural integrity in Westville. The rain cap is inspected for correct fit, mesh integrity, and physical condition in Westville, IL. The full flashing system is inspected close-up from the rooftop in Westville. Counter flashing sealant condition. Base flashing metal condition. Step flashing integrity on all four chimney sides in Westville, IL. The exterior chimney masonry is assessed for mortar joint condition, brick spalling, and efflorescence patterns in Westville.

The Camera Inspection

The Camera Inspection — What It Shows and Why It Matters in Westville, IL

What Camera Inspection Sees That Direct Observation Cannot in Westville

The camera scan is the defining element of a Level 2 inspection in Westville, IL. It travels the complete flue from the firebox to the chimney top and produces direct visual documentation of liner condition throughout in Westville. Hairline cracks in clay tile liner sections that are completely invisible to direct observation from the firebox or chimney top in Westville, IL. Mortar joint separation between liner sections that allows combustion gases to migrate into the surrounding masonry in Westville. Physical liner damage from chimney fires including cracked and displaced tile sections in Westville, IL. Evidence of previous chimney fires that the homeowner may not know occurred in Westville. And previous repair attempts including whether they addressed the complete extent of the damage or only the accessible sections in Westville, IL.

Why Real Estate Transactions Require Level 2 in Westville

NFPA 211 requires Level 2 inspection when a property changes hands in Westville, IL. The requirement exists because the chimney is one of the most expensive systems in the home to repair when significant conditions are found, and its most significant conditions are only identifiable through camera inspection of the liner in Westville. A general home inspector's visual assessment from below the firebox and from ground level outside is not a substitute for the camera scan that Level 2 requires in Westville, IL. It is a different scope and a different level of information in Westville.

A chimney fire occurs when creosote deposits in the flue ignite in Westville. It burns at temperatures exceeding 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it and produces physical stress on the liner that causes cracking and mortar joint separation in clay tile liners in Westville, IL. Many chimney fires are not recognized as such because they may burn out quickly without dramatic visible signs in Westville. Camera inspection reveals the specific physical damage signatures that distinguish chimney fire damage from normal thermal cycling deterioration in Westville, IL.
